    Abstract: A power management and smart lighting system is provided that enables efficient distribution of DC power to various building features, including LED lighting. The power management system includes an intelligent power supply unit configured to convert AC power drawn from a building load center into a deadband DC waveform. The deadband DC power generated by the intelligent power supply unit is then transmitted over power-with-Ethernet cables to a plurality of distributed intelligent drivers, each configured to intelligently power one or more LED troffers. The intelligent drivers may be daisy-chained to one another by the power-with-Ethernet cables, enabling a power-ring architecture. To enable easy control of the drivers, intelligent sensors can be distributed throughout the topology and connected to the drivers (e.g., via power-with-Ethernet cables) to enable a wide array of lighting control options.

    Abstract: A method of monitoring main contact conditions of main contacts in an automatic transfer switch is provided. The automatic transfer switch is coupled to a plurality of electrical power sources and an electrical load. The method includes: measuring, by sensors, temperatures of a plurality of main contacts coupled to the plurality of power sources; determining if the measured temperatures indicate a temperature rise at one or more main contacts of the plurality of main contacts; in response to determining that the measured temperatures indicate a temperature rise at the one or more main contacts, comparing a current value of the temperature rise with stored temperature rise values that represent main contact damages; and determining an amount of main contact damage at the one or more main contacts based on the comparison.

    Abstract: A method and system for adaptively docking with computers of different designs are provided. In one version, an electrical communications connector (hereinafter, “docking connector”) is coupled with a docking station frame, wherein the docking connector may be positioned relative to the frame. A computer having a native connector may be positioned relative to the frame, and the docking connector may be positioned relative to both the frame and the computer to permit communicative coupling of the docking connector and the native connector of the computer.
